09.09.202610:39:02UTC+00Portugal Trade Deficit Narrows in July as Exports Outpace Imports

Portugal’s trade deficit narrowed to €3.05 billion in July 2026, from €3.45 billion in July 2025. Exports rose 6.5% to €7.40 billion, largely driven by a 46.6% surge in fuels and lubricants, reflecting higher energy prices and renewed escalation in the US-Iran war. Shipments also increased for industrial supplies (8.1%) and machinery and other capital goods (12.5%), while exports of transport equipment fell 9.3%, mainly due to weaker passenger-car sales.

By destination, exports to Spain grew 11%, whereas shipments to the UK and the Netherlands declined 10.3% and 12.1%, respectively.

Imports edged up 0.6% to €10.45 billion. This modest increase was led by a 42.7% jump in fuels and lubricants and a 10.2% rise in machinery and other capital goods. In contrast, imports of industrial supplies fell 14.2%, driven primarily by lower chemicals purchases.

On a geographical basis, imports increased from France (25.6%), Spain (4.3%), and Nigeria (584.8%), but plunged from Ireland (81.2%).

Over the first seven months of 2026, however, Portugal’s cumulative trade deficit widened to €21.35 billion, from €18.87 billion in the same period a year earlier.
